How Tokenization is Enabling the Creation of Digital Goods Markets
Tokenization is revolutionizing the way we think about ownership and trading in the digital space. By converting physical or digital assets into a digital token that can be stored on a blockchain, tokenization enables the creation of decentralized marketplaces for digital goods. This innovative approach is reshaping industries, from art to gaming, and is opening up new avenues for creators and consumers alike.
One of the most significant benefits of tokenization is its ability to enhance transparency and traceability. In traditional markets, the provenance of a digital asset can often be opaque. However, with blockchain technology, every transaction involving a tokenized asset is recorded and verifiable. This ensures that buyers can confidently purchase digital goods knowing their authenticity and ownership history.
Furthermore, tokenization reduces barriers to entry for both creators and buyers. Artists and content creators can mint their works as non-fungible tokens ( NFTs), allowing them to directly engage with their audience. This direct interaction eliminates the need for intermediaries, ensuring that creators receive a larger share of the revenue generated from sales. As a result, tokenization empowers individuals by providing them with more control over their creations.
The creation of digital goods markets through tokenization also promotes fractional ownership. This means that instead of purchasing an entire asset outright, individuals can buy a fraction of a digital item, making it more accessible to a broader audience. For example, a high-profile piece of digital art can be tokenized so that multiple investors own a portion of it. This democratizes the art market and allows more people to participate in investments that were previously out of reach.
Moreover, tokenized digital goods can introduce new revenue streams through secondary markets. When someone buys a digital asset, they can also sell or trade it easily, thanks to blockchain technology. This not only creates liquidity within the market but also encourages continuous valuation of digital goods. Creators could even benefit from future sales through smart contracts, receiving a percentage every time a tokenized asset is sold to a new owner.
The gaming industry has also seen notable transformations due to tokenization. With the emergence of play-to-earn models, players can earn real-world value from the digital items they acquire while gaming. Tokenization allows players to own in-game assets, trade them, and even sell them outside the game environment. This creates an engaging economy around gaming, where players invest time and money into assets that can appreciate in value.
